Date: Thu, 13 Nov 2014 19:13:09 +0200 From: Konstantin Belousov <kostikbel@gmail.com> To: ppc@freebsd.org, toolchain@freebsd.org Subject: llvm build error on ppc Message-ID: <20141113171308.GZ17068@kib.kiev.ua>
next in thread | raw e-mail | index | archive | help
FYI, I did make tinderbox today for HEAD at r274464, and got the following both for ppc and ppc64 worlds. Other arches build successfully. =3D=3D=3D> lib/clang/libllvmtablegen (all) /scratch/tmp/kib/src/lib/clang/libllvmselectiondag/../../../contrib/llvm/li= b/CodeGen/SelectionDAG/SelectionDAG.cpp: In member function 'void llvm::SDD= bgInfo::erase(const llvm::SDNode*)': /scratch/tmp/kib/src/lib/clang/libllvmselectiondag/../../../contrib/llvm/li= b/CodeGen/SelectionDAG/SelectionDAG.cpp:632: error: a function-definition i= s not allowed here before ':' token /scratch/tmp/kib/src/lib/clang/libllvmselectiondag/../../../contrib/llvm/li= b/CodeGen/SelectionDAG/SelectionDAG.cpp:634: error: could not convert '((ll= vm::DenseMapBase<llvm::DenseMap<const llvm::SDNode*, llvm::SmallVector<llvm= ::SDDbgValue*, 2u>, llvm::DenseMapInfo<const llvm::SDNode*> >, const llvm::= SDNode*, llvm::SmallVector<llvm::SDDbgValue*, 2u>, llvm::DenseMapInfo<const= llvm::SDNode*> >*)(&((llvm::SDDbgInfo*)this)->llvm::SDDbgInfo::DbgValMap))= ->llvm::DenseMapBase<DerivedT, KeyT, ValueT, KeyInfoT>::erase [with Derived= T =3D llvm::DenseMap<const llvm::SDNode*, llvm::SmallVector<llvm::SDDbgValu= e*, 2u>, llvm::DenseMapInfo<const llvm::SDNode*> >, KeyT =3D const llvm::SD= Node*, ValueT =3D llvm::SmallVector<llvm::SDDbgValue*, 2u>, KeyInfoT =3D ll= vm::DenseMapInfo<const llvm::SDNode*>](llvm::DenseMapIterator<const llvm::S= DNode*, llvm::SmallVector<llvm::SDDbgValue*, 2u>, llvm::DenseMapInfo<const = llvm::SDNode*>, false>(((const llvm::DenseMapIterator<const llvm::SDNode*, = llvm::SmallVector<llvm::SDDbgValue*, 2u>, llvm::DenseMapInfo<const llvm::SD= Node*>, false>&)((const llvm::DenseMapIterator<const llvm::SDNode*, llvm::S= mallVector<llvm::SDDbgValue*, 2u>, llvm::DenseMapInfo<const llvm::SDNode*>,= false>*)(& I)))))' to 'bool' /scratch/tmp/kib/src/lib/clang/libllvmselectiondag/../../../contrib/llvm/li= b/CodeGen/SelectionDAG/SelectionDAG.cpp:635: error: expected primary-expres= sion before '}' token /scratch/tmp/kib/src/lib/clang/libllvmselectiondag/../../../contrib/llvm/li= b/CodeGen/SelectionDAG/SelectionDAG.cpp:635: error: expected `)' before '}'= token /scratch/tmp/kib/src/lib/clang/libllvmselectiondag/../../../contrib/llvm/li= b/CodeGen/SelectionDAG/SelectionDAG.cpp:635: error: expected primary-expres= sion before '}' token /scratch/tmp/kib/src/lib/clang/libllvmselectiondag/../../../contrib/llvm/li= b/CodeGen/SelectionDAG/SelectionDAG.cpp:635: error: expected `;' before '}'= token --- SelectionDAG.o --- *** [SelectionDAG.o] Error code 1 make[8]: stopped in /scratch/tmp/kib/src/lib/clang/libllvmselectiondag 1 error
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20141113171308.GZ17068>